No, yellow generally does not mean calm. While bright yellow can evoke feelings of happiness and cheerfulness, lighter shades of yellow are more likely to promote a calm feeling.
Here's a breakdown:
-
Bright Yellow: Often associated with energy, excitement, and happiness. It's stimulating and can even be overwhelming if used excessively.
-
Light/Soft Yellow: This shade is more likely to be perceived as calm, gentle, and soothing. It's often used in nurseries and spaces where a sense of peace is desired. The reference states, "Light yellows also give a more calm feeling of happiness than bright yellows."
In summary, the effect of yellow depends heavily on its shade and intensity. Brighter yellows tend to be stimulating, while softer yellows can induce a sense of calm.
